The premiere of HBO’s Insecure in 2016 marked a watershed moment. Adapted from Issa Rae’s web series Awkward Black Girl , the show brought a raw, premium aesthetic to the messy realities of dating, friendship, and career stagnation for millennial Black women in Los Angeles. The 1990s and 2000s witnessed the ascendance of hip-hop and R&B, with artists like Tupac Shakur, The Notorious B.I.G., Beyoncé, and Kanye West dominating the airwaves. Their music often explored mature themes like violence, racism, love, and personal growth, resonating with diverse audiences worldwide.
